Fluent Forms Logo Usage Guidelines

The Fluent Forms logo pairs our distinctive abstract ‘F’ icon with the Fluent Forms wordmark.

The primary horizontal version is recommended for most applications.

To maintain clarity and impact, avoid using the logo at sizes that compromise legibility, and always use the official logo files provided.

Logo Scale Guidelines

For smaller applications, use the dedicated small-size logo variation. It’s optimized for widths between 140px and 240px to maintain clarity and visual balance.

When the logo needs to appear even smaller, between 30px and 70px in height, use only the Fluent Forms icon. Avoid using the stacked logo at these sizes to preserve readability and brand consistency.”

Icon’s Guidelines

Dos

  • Do use enough space around our icon to avoid clutter and prevent confusion with other brands or products.
  • Do make sure to keep the proportions and aspect ratio equal.
  • Ensure our logo and icon are large enough to be legible.
  • Do include our icon when linking to our websites or products.

Don’ts

  • Don’t alter our icons’ colors or shapes, or combine it with other elements.

  • Don’t feature us or our logos on any age-restricted, drug-related, or illegal content.
  • Don’t imply partnership, endorsement, or association unless you have direct approval from WP Manage Ninja LLC leadership.
  • Don’t use names, logos, or other materials that imitate or could be confused with the Fluent Forms brand or WPManageNinja products.

Writing Guidelines

The do’s and don’ts of talking about Fluent Forms in your content or copy.

Dos

  • Do display the name “Fluent Forms” with proper capitalization and spacing, except when used as a web address.
  • Do use the same font style and size for “Fluent Forms” as the surrounding content.
  • Do ensure the name “Fluent Forms” is legible in all copy.

Don’ts

  • Don’t abbreviate or use “Fluent Forms” as a verb.
  • Don’t display the name “Fluent Forms” with without spacing or as “FluentForms”
  • Don’t attempt to style the name “Fluent Forms” using our brand fonts or similar fonts in text.
